Whether he’s depicting a rocky cliff amid a calm sea, a pop culture moment or a vase of daisies atop a kitchen table, artist James Strombotne creates subdued, stylized images that feature rich color pairings and brim with life.

Born in Watertown, South Dakota, Strombotne grew up in Southern California. In 1956, he received his Bachelor of Arts degree from Pomona College. He then went on to earn his Master of Fine Arts from the Claremont Graduate School in 1959. He also received a fellowship from Pomona College to study abroad in Italy. In 1962, the Guggenheim Foundation awarded him a fellowship to continue his international studies in Rome.

Strombotne had his first solo show in 1956 at the Studio 44 gallery in San Francisco. Over the course of his career, he had more than 75 solo exhibitions and a dozen retrospectives across the United States.

In the 1970s, Strombotne began teaching art at the University of California in Riverside. He continued to paint and exhibit throughout his teaching years. He taught at the same school for 40 years until his retirement in 2005. 

Strombotne’s work is held in many public and private collections, including the Museum of Modern Art in New York, the Whitney Museum of American Art and the San Francisco Museum of Modern Art. He lives in Orange County, California, where he keeps a studio and continues to create art.

The present work of art titled "Urban Abstraction (ripped off posters)" is part of a series of paintings that the artist composed in the 1980s and 1990s inspired by the observation of the urban reality of those years. The artist take the cue from his walks in Florence, both in the center and in the suburbs, and by the observation of billboards and posters scattered throughout the city. The mass of information, colors, messages and words were carried on the canvas with acrylic colors, ideally reconstructing the tears and overlaps of all the information and advertising contained on these huge sheets of paper that invade our cities. The geometric lines are overlaid with jagged lines, overlaps and color dripping and also the choice in the color palette, with different shades of white, gray, rose, orange red and blue helps in rendering the result of the tears and ripped paper. The result is a beautiful multicolored modern abstract canvas, both aesthetically and ethically, with many rich layers of color, texture and expression in which the artist leaves his own message.
